一般描述
乙醇钽(Ta(OC2H5)5 )是一种醇盐钽 ,可用作化学气相沉积(CVD)法制备氧化钽的前体。它具有良好的挥发性和热稳定性。它可以在无水乙醇中通过钽板的阳极氧化来合成。
应用
Ta(OC2H5)5 可用于形成超薄氧化钽电容器。它也可用作制备碳化钽纳米粉的液体前体,用于金属表面硬化。
